On average across the year,
yes, China is hotter than
Waterloo, Ontario
.
China has an average temperature of 15°C/59°F and Waterloo, Ontario has an average temperature of 7°C/45°F.
China's hottest month is July, with an average maximum temperature of 31°C/88°F, which is hotter than Waterloo, Ontario's hottest month (also July, with an average maximum temperature of 26°C/79°F).
On average across the year, no, China is not colder than Waterloo, Ontario . China has an average minimum temperature of 10°C/50°F and Waterloo, Ontario has an average minimum temperature of 3°C/37°F.
On average across the year,
no, China has less rain than
Waterloo, Ontario. China has an average annual rainfall of 613mm and Waterloo, Ontario has an average annual rainfall of 1104mm.
China's wettest month is July, with an average monthly rainfall of 107mm, which is drier than Waterloo, Ontario's wettest month (October, with an average monthly rainfall of 122mm).
